Interior Paint

I been wanting to re paint my interior, I tried some of the rustolium and duplicolor interior paint and on the arm rests it only lasted a day. Anyways I really want a darker tan, like the tan from the Eddie Bauer edition trucks. Are more colors available for out trucks?

I am going to go pick up some Eddie Bauer door panels tomorrow, if there still at the junkyard.

Can I use regular paint for plastic?

I wouldn't paint or dye any areas that get touched on a regular basis, like armrests, steering wheel, or seats unless you would want to do it again every now and then. For interior plastics, it's best to use an interior dye/paint that is specifically made for that.

I used a duplicolor spray, with interior primer, and it is holding well on a center console I did. I scuffed it up very lightly with steel wool to help it hold also. I wouldnt use regular spray paint, as it will come off pretty quickly. The plastics need to be able to flex. I've seen cars in the junkyard people tried customizing with regular spray paint, and the paint was flaking and cracked.
